Subject: Quickstore 4.2 — bloom filter now fronts the KV layer

Plugin authors: starting with this release, Quickstore places a bloom filter ahead of the key-value store. Negative lookups return faster; false positives fall through safely. No API changes are required on your side. Verify your plugin against the staging build referenced below.

session token of fahif-tadup = htk3_9c7

**Ticket: Config drift in catalog cache invalidation**

The Shopgrove product catalog's cache invalidation settings have drifted between staging and production. Production still uses the old TTL-based purge, while staging was moved to event-driven invalidation last quarter. Stale prices were reported twice this month. Future maintainers should treat the staging setup as canonical. For reference, the intended invalidation configuration is listed below.

settings of fafog-haduf:
ZORIX_PIN=4648
ZORIX_METRICS_HOST=metrics.zorix.paliqsys.corp
ZORIX_LOG_LEVEL=info
ZORIX_TENANT=druix

## Runbook: Rolling Back the Bramblewick Query Planner

If the planner regression reappears (symptom: nested-loop joins chosen over hash joins on the ledger tables), do not patch live. Pin the prior planner version via the feature flag, capture three slow-query plans for the postmortem, then build the hotfix from the maintenance branch. Hotfix artifacts must be signed before the deploy gate accepts them, using the key below.

release key, yagap-kagag: bky6_1ks93y